Meet our local producers

Nambucca Valley is home to the Gumbaynggirr people who were traditionally known as the ‘sharing people’ because their land was so rich and fertile that food and other resources were commonly shared with other nations.   


The Spirit of the Rainforest is a place of natural and remnant rainforest that offers established gardens with edible plants to sample, including the native Davidson Plum.   

North Arm Farms is a collective of three family farms The Mandarin BendAutarky Farm &  Harvest Owl that connect our community to fresh, seasonal & nourishing produce.  

Funkya@Unkya are our sustainable bi-monthly markets where you can meet local growers and the community to learn and stock up on seasonal produce.
